Find the cartesian and vector equation of a line which passes through the point (1, 2, 3) and parallel to the line `(-x-2)/1=(y+3)/7=(2z-6)/3`

Text Solution

Verified by Experts

The correct Answer is:
`(x-1)/(-2)=(y-2)/14=(z-3)/3`
`vecr=(hati+2hatj+3hatk)+lambda(-2hati+14hatj+3hatk)`
